free games online no download no registration Fundamentals Explained
Introducing point out-of-the-art multiplayer gaming modes wherever players join forces to execute assassinations or contend versus each other in stealth missions, the game claims an extraordinary online gaming practical experience. Its wealthy historic setting and exceptional gameplay mechanics ensure an appropriate hold in 2025.Great for players w